979,744 (nine hundred seventy-nine thousand seven hundred forty-four)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2⁵ × 17 × 1,801. Its proper divisors sum to 1,063,724,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xEF320.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 979744, here are decompositions:

  • 53 + 979691 = 979744
  • 191 + 979553 = 979744
  • 263 + 979481 = 979744
  • 383 + 979361 = 979744
  • 401 + 979343 = 979744
  • 431 + 979313 = 979744
  • 461 + 979283 = 979744
  • 641 + 979103 = 979744

Showing the first eight; more decompositions exist.
